Thanks for your interest in becoming a database reviewer! Database reviewers are like backend reviewers but with a special focus on the database. As a result, there are some special challenges they may face in the course of their necessary work.

Before becoming a database reviewer, we ask that you complete the following steps to be sure you're prepared!

New reviewer tasks

  • Change merge request to include your name: Add Database Reviewer: Your Name
  • Review general code review guidelines
  • Familiarize yourself with how to review for database
  • Ask to be added to @gl-database, this handle is used to inform and consult with database folks about updates to the database review process.
  • Read Understanding EXPLAIN plans
  • Read up on what to do if you're feeling overwhelmed by database reviews
  • Optional (but recommended): Open an access request for (if you don't have them already):
    • AllFeaturesUser access in postgres.ai
    • The db-lab chef role for psql access to database lab
    • Developer role in the ops testing pipeline project.
  • Mention the database team manager for awareness: @alexives for visibility
  • Assign the issue to your manager to merge

Note that approving and accepting merge requests is restricted to Database Maintainers only. As a reviewer, pass the MR to a maintainer for approval.

Where to go for questions?

Reach out to #database on Slack
